Facebook And Instagram To Restrict Some Content

MENLO PARK, Ca. – There are a few changes coming to Facebook and Instagram.

Starting Wednesday, anyone under 18 will not be able to see alcohol, tobacco or e-cigarette content on either platform.

A spokesperson says the company is also restricting private sales, trades, transfers or giving alcohol and tobacco products as gifts and, if there are, the content will have to be restricted to those 18 and up.


This also applies to any Facebook groups created to sell alcohol or tobacco products.

The spokesperson also says the new policy had been in the works and is not a response to this week’s congressional hearings.
